Player Character creation

Character creation steps


1) Roll 3d6 for each ability score
2) Write down the ability score bonus or penalty for each score
3) Choose a race / Write down the special abilities of your race
4) Choose a class / Write down the special abilities of your class
5) Write down the experience points needed to advance to second level
6) Roll the hit die for your class, adding your Constitution bonus or penalty
7) Roll for your starting money (3d6 X 10 gold pieces)
8) Purchase equipment for your character (apply weapon and armor restrictions for your class and race)
9) Write down your Armor Class adding your Dexterity bonus or penalty
10) Write down your attack bonus
11) Write down your saving throws numbers (adjust the figures by your race bonus or penalty)

Character Creation Options


Allow the player to "move" points from one Ability Score to another, at a rate of -2 to one score for each +1 added
to the other. The maximum score is still 18 (or the racial maximum if lower), and the player should not be
allowed to lower any score below 9.
Let the player exchange any two Ability Scores, once per character.
Let the player arrange the six Ability Score values as he or she wishes.

* On a hit roll a natural "1" is always a failure. A natural "20" is always a hit, if the opponent can be hit at all

Treasure
To generate a random treasure, find the indicated treasure type assigned to monsters and read across; where a
percentage chance is given, roll percentile dice to see if that sort of treasure is found. If so, roll the indicated dice to
determine how much.
